首页 > 其他分享 >pycnblog——上传博客园

pycnblog——上传博客园

时间:2023-07-04 13:12:23浏览次数:48  
标签:markdown 博客园 cmd blog 右键 快捷方式 上传 pycnblog

目录

1、功能

  • 一键拖拽上传
  • 默认“未发布”,可选择直接发布
  • 重复上传,提示是否更新博客

2、环境

(1)Python 3

  • 安装 pyyaml 库:cmd中输入 pip3 install pyyaml

252274b5022933c43e4859daedd50c9

3、配置

在config.yaml中,填写博客配置信息

blog_url: https://rpc.cnblogs.com/metaweblog/DQ-MINE
blog_id: "DQ-MINE"
username: "德琪"
password: "79775C0840357F37………………………………………………………2E70EE9D322B172D8AC745AD3E531"
image-20230704113305024
blog_url:
blog_id:
  • blog_id就是访问地址的尾巴: "DQ-MINE"
username:
  • username是登录用户名: "德琪"
password
  • password:博客园6.21更新,MetaWeblog现在不支持密码登录,需要通过访问令牌(access token)登录,在博客后台设置页面,允许MetaWeblog博客客户端访问,下方有MetaWeblog访问令牌 ,点击查看,创建访问令牌。

4、运行

(1)点击运行pycnblog-master文件夹中的 cnblog_markdown_cmd 文件,提示Please input file path:

(2)将编辑好的md文件拖进窗口中,回车

5、添加快捷方式

​ 应用了上述方法后,编写 markdown 到上传到博客园的步骤变得简单了许多,不用再一张张图片的上传了。但是,依旧会输入一些命令才能实现,比较复杂,不长期使用很难记住。

设置「右键→→发送到」的功能

(1)打开cnblog_markdown.cmd安装文件夹,右键发送到——桌面快捷方式

image-20230704124948356

  • 打开「我的电脑」,在地址栏中输入%AppData%\Microsoft\Windows\SendTo并按下回车键:

  • 把刚才生成到桌面的cnblog_markdown.cmd快捷方式移动到该目录下
  • 这样就可以在所要上传的文件处右键——》发送到cnblog_markdown.cmd,然后拖拽上传

image-20230704125221938

image-20230704125332417

注意:Typora偏好设置——》图像设置

image-20230704125439160

标签:markdown,博客园,cmd,blog,右键,快捷方式,上传,pycnblog
From: https://www.cnblogs.com/DQ-MINE/p/17525490.html

相关文章

  • Silence - 博客园主题配置
    Silence-博客园主题配置部署指南https://esofar.github.io/cnblogs-theme-silence/#/guide配置选项下列所有选项均需要配置在「页脚HTML代码」处的window.$silence中配置用户选项avatar类型:String默认值:null该配置项用来设置左侧栏中博主头像图片,未......
  • java http大文件断点续传上传组件
    ​ 我们平时经常做的是上传文件,上传文件夹与上传文件类似,但也有一些不同之处,这次做了上传文件夹就记录下以备后用。首先我们需要了解的是上传文件三要素:1.表单提交方式:post(get方式提交有大小限制,post没有)2.表单的enctype属性:必须设置为multipart/form-data.3.表单必须......
  • 文件上传相关思路
     举例:新增单位信息时,经常会遇到上传单位照片,如营业执照。当用户选择营业执照后图片就会上传至服务器,并返回文件路径用于提交表单保存单位信息使用。假设用户选择营业执照后点击了取消操作并没有提交表单,或者刷新、关闭了页面,服务器就会存放无用的垃圾图片数据。当用户量到一......
  • C# 上传文件至指定目录,并返回文件路径
     ///<summary>///上传图片并返回文件路径///</summary>///<paramname="file"></param>///<returns></returns>[HttpPost("UploadImage")]publicasync......
  • input 上传图片 Base64 格式的 可预览
      <inputtype="file"@change="aas"name=""id="">   aas(e){//console.log(e.target.files)//leta=newFormData        letfile=e.target.files[0]        letreader=newFileReader......
  • 博客园同步GitHub功能
    博客园VIP服务增加了GitHub的同步功能,本文一方面作为介绍,另一方面作为尝试,记录一下使用方法和体验。1.开通博客园的VIP服务GitHub的同步功能目前仅限VIP会员。因此需要开通VIP服务,开通后可以在设置中看到同步服务的选项。VIP服务链接:https://cnblogs.vip/99元/年的价格其......
  • 29. Spring boot 文件上传(多文件上传)【从零开始学Spring Boot】
    文件上传主要分以下几个步骤:(1)新建mavenjavaproject;(2)在pom.xml加入相应依赖;(3)新建一个表单页面(这里使用thymeleaf);(4)编写controller;(5)测试;(6)对上传的文件做一些限制;(7)多文件上传实现(1)新建mavenjavaproject新建一个名称为spring-boot-fileuploadmavenjava项目;(2)在pom.xml......
  • elementui 手动上传文件 post 请求
    //上传图片校验  fileChange(file){   constisJPG=file.raw.type==='image/jpeg'   constisPNG=file.raw.type==='image/png'   constisLt2M=file.raw.size/1024/1024<0.2   if(!isPNG&&!isJPG){   ......
  • 博客园载入图片模糊
      将图片地址中末尾的t改为o即可,在点开详细路径后你会发现,前缀是o的图片比前缀为t的图片要大很多 ......
  • 小工具 | cnblogs自动上传图片并生成markdown
    博客文章在本地都是用typora写的,文本可以直接复制上去,图片一个个上传太麻烦,这里推荐一个dotnet工具,给一个本地的typora文档,它会自动读取图片,上传到cnblogs,并替换掉原文档里的图片链接很方便,mark一下,工具地址为链接......